Как стать автором
Обновить
-6
0
roboter @roboter

Пользователь

Отправить сообщение

Управляем автоматом на Groovy/Java. Как ЧПУ станку в домашней мастерской не превратиться в мульт героев «двое из ларца»

Время на прочтение9 мин
Количество просмотров17K
Поговорим на темы от труда и работы, станков, автоматизации на java/groovy до прогнозов о будущем человечества.

Узнаете про персональное автоматизированное производство в домашней мастерской, как идея творца превращается в готовое изделие. Рассмотрим подход по отправке G-code инструкций из JVM и groovy/java на исполнение ЧПУ станку для автоматизации того, чего нет в системе «из коробки».


Надеюсь, эта публикация будет познавательна программистам работающих с JVM, тем кто интересуется темой IoT, кому не чуждо мастерить, кто думает о покупке 3D принтера, кто делал прототип какой-либо системы и запускал ПО на Raspberry PI/Beagleboard Black. То про что расскажу, можно повторить используя open source software и open hardware.
Внимание, в публикации много иллюстраций! И лучше не есть при просмотре техники безопасности...
Всего голосов 21: ↑19 и ↓2+17
Комментарии36

Применение 3D-печати в ремонте и тюнинге автомобилей

Время на прочтение10 мин
Количество просмотров60K

Автомобильная тематика знакома и близка многим. Мы любим смотреть на красивые и быстрые автомобили, а некоторые счастливчики управляют такими автомобилями или их создают.

Сегодня поговорим о применении технологии 3D печати и 3D сканирования в автомобилестроении.

Мы не будем рассматривать амбициозные и спорные проекты компаний по печати автомобиля целиком, а рассмотрим более простое и доступное применение данной технологии.
Всего голосов 20: ↑16 и ↓4+12
Комментарии17

Отладка php в Visual Studio Code (Xdebug, Windows)

Время на прочтение2 мин
Количество просмотров69K

В некоторых случаях может возникнуть необходимость отладки приложений на php. Visual Studio code предоставляет такую возможность при условии установки дополнительного расширения PHP Debug (marketplace, github).


Читать дальше →
Всего голосов 17: ↑15 и ↓2+13
Комментарии10

Создание динамических time-lapse с помощью микроконтроллера

Время на прочтение2 мин
Количество просмотров7.9K
Когда то у меня была мыльница Canon и у нее был вход типа мини джек. Через который к фотоаппарату можно было подключить интервелометр и снимать таймлапсы. Интервелометр это такая штука которая может автоматически нажимать на спуск с заданным интервалом времени.
Всего голосов 21: ↑20 и ↓1+19
Комментарии24

Material Design и AngularJS

Время на прочтение6 мин
Количество просмотров68K
Ни для кого не секрет, что Google повсюду в своих продуктах внедряет так называемый material design. Как и любой другой стиль он имеет сторонников и противников. Не буду касаться этих споров. Если вам нравится данный подход, Google подготовил полную спецификацию и описание особенностей: Material Design.

Для любителей angularjs появилась библиотека с набором директив, реализующих графические компоненты и позволяющих создавать разметку в соответствии с принципами material design. О ней и пойдет рассказ.

Я постараюсь кратко показать некоторые особенности и недостатки, а также покажу небольшое приложение для демонстрации.

image
Читать дальше →
Всего голосов 37: ↑35 и ↓2+33
Комментарии20

DRM-защиту игровой приставки Sega Saturn взломали спустя 20 лет

Время на прочтение4 мин
Количество просмотров35K

Теперь игры загружаются в обход привода CD-ROM




Опытные геймеры наверняка помнят Sega Saturn — 32-битную игровую приставку от компании Sega. Она начала продаваться 22 ноября 1994 года, на две недели раньше главного конкурента — первой модели Sony Playstation. Это была настоящая бомба. В первый же день фанаты выкупили 170 000 экземпляров новой «Сеги». В 1995 году приставка появилась в продаже в Европе и США, где её тоже ждал успех: на неё портировали Quake, C&C, Tomb Raider, Duke Nukem 3D и другие игры.

На момент выхода архитектура Sega Saturn была гораздо более продвинутой, чем у любой другой игровой приставки. Saturn была очень мощной системой для своего времени: два центральных RISC-процессора (Hitachi SuperH-2 7604), два видеопроцессора (собственной разработки), 32-битный звук (звуковой DSP-процессор Yamaha FH1), CD-привод двойной скорости.
Читать дальше →
Всего голосов 53: ↑52 и ↓1+51
Комментарии56

Почему мы рады тому, что не попали на themeforest

Время на прочтение4 мин
Количество просмотров30K

Наша команда начала работать над Admin Dashboard Template (мы называем её просто админка) для themeforest 9 месяцев назад. Забегая вперед, на этот маркетплейс мы так и не попали, но сильно не расстроились и сегодня рады поделиться с сообществом результатами нашей кропотливой работы и, надеемся, интересной и полезной историей.

Ссылки для нетерпеливых:

angular 1 версия: https://github.com/akveo/blur-admin (демо: blur, mint)
angular 2 версия: https://github.com/akveo/ng2-admin (демо)

Будем рады любым комментариям, замечаниям и пожеланиям.
Надеемся, что BlurAdmin вам понравится, и, если сообщество сочтет этот проект полезным, мы с удовольствием продолжим его поддерживать и прикручивать новые фичи.

Читать дальше →
Всего голосов 55: ↑48 и ↓7+41
Комментарии72

Все уроки по ардуино

Время на прочтение5 мин
Количество просмотров282K
Однажды появилась необходимость собрать все уроки, обучающие материалы (tutorials) с habrahabr и geektimes в одном месте и немного их систематизировать. В этом сборнике обучаек представлены более 100 статей на тему ардуино с пометкой «tutorial», либо содержащие несложные для новичков проекты на ардуино, а также немного видеоуроков по смежным темам. Статьи разделены на 10 тематик по сферам применения собранных устройств. Также хочется напомнить, что весь обучающий материал, опубликованный на habrahabr и geektimes является интерактивным: в любой момент можно задать вопрос автору в комментариях к статье. Как правило авторы на них отвечают. Этот сборник будет дополняться новыми обучайками (tutorials) по мере их публикации.

Читать дальше →
Всего голосов 39: ↑36 и ↓3+33
Комментарии25

Шесть подработок для ИТ-специалиста, за которые платят в долларах

Время на прочтение5 мин
Количество просмотров117K


Не поймали за хвост удачу в виде главного бага известного сервиса, нет желания “толкаться” на oDesk или не хочется делать то же, что уже и так делаете в рабочее время?

Мы нашли альтернативные и не суперконкурентные варианты: излагать технический опыт по-английский, получать ренту с кода или завести монетизируемое хобби, связанное с математикой, инженерией или общением.

Три пункта не про работу
Всего голосов 75: ↑40 и ↓35+5
Комментарии62

Векторная графика бесплатно — подборка сайтов

Время на прочтение3 мин
Количество просмотров422K
У векторной графики много преимуществ. В отличие от растровых, векторные изображения более гибкие, легко масштабируются, сохраняют качество и т.д. Ниже представлена подборка веб-ресурсов с бесплатными векторными иконками, символами и картинками.

1. Freepik


www.freepik.com

Один из самых больших веб-сайтов, который предлагает сотни новых векторных изображений для личного и для коммерческого использования.



Читать дальше →
Всего голосов 41: ↑34 и ↓7+27
Комментарии3

ESP8266 прошивка, программирование в Arduino IDE

Время на прочтение4 мин
Количество просмотров523K
И снова привет Хабр. Этот материал является продолжением моей предыдущей статьи — ESP8266 и Arduino, подключение, распиновка, и, должен сказать, что они взаимосвязаны. Я не буду затрагивать темы, которые уже раскрыты.

А сегодня, я поведаю, как же программировать ESP8266 при помощи Arduino IDE, так же прошивать другие прошивки, например NodeMcu… Вообщем, этот материал не ограничивается только одной темой Ардуино.

image

Тема ESP8266 — довольно таки непростая. Но, если работать с этими Wi-Fi модулями в среде разработки Arduino IDE — порог вхождения опускается до приемлемого для обычного ардуинщика уровня. Да и не только ардуинщика, а любого человека, у которого есть желание сварганить что-то по теме IoT(интернет вещей), причём не затрачивая много времени читая документацию для микросхемы и изучение API для этих модулей.



Данное видео, полностью дублирует материал, представленный в статье ниже.
Читать дальше...
Всего голосов 21: ↑20 и ↓1+19
Комментарии32

Система проветривания комнаты на основе «малинки» и «Детектора СО2»

Время на прочтение4 мин
Количество просмотров20K
Мода на умные дома захлестнула весь интернет, каждый нынче хочет сделать лампочку, которая умеет выключаться через интернет или пощёлкать вентилятором в туалете. Мой опыт был достаточно прост: я хотел сделать систему, которая умеет автоматически проветривать комнату, ни больше, ни меньше.

После обдумывания принципа работы системы пришел к некоторым выводам, которые и решил реализовать. По задумке, весь функционал системы делится на три составляющие: «мозги» которые всем управляют, система открывания форточки/или включение вентилятора и сам датчик который следит за качеством воздуха в помещении. Вот о сенсоре качества воздуха далее я и расскажу, плюс немного затрону тему интеграции его с “мозгами” умного дома.
Читать дальше →
Всего голосов 26: ↑20 и ↓6+14
Комментарии40

Отладка кода Arduino (AVR). Часть 1. Виртуальная отладка

Время на прочтение11 мин
Количество просмотров66K

Предисловие


Как известно, среда Arduino (AVR) не содержит функции внутрисхемной отладки, что создаёт большие неудобства при поиске сложных ошибок и сопровождении проектов. Я хочу показать два способа, при помощи которых вы сможете отлаживать свои скетчи разного уровня сложности. Для первого способа вам понадобятся только программы, а для второго нужен недорогой (по сравнению с оригинальным отладчиком) адаптер, который вы можете либо собрать самостоятельно, либо купить готовый.
В общем, ничего нового для тех, кто пользуется отладчиками постоянно, но может быть полезным для пользователей Arduino (AVR).
Читать дальше →
Всего голосов 10: ↑10 и ↓0+10
Комментарии23

Новые бесплатные курсы виртуальной академии Microsoft Virtual Academy, февраль 2016

Время на прочтение5 мин
Количество просмотров22K


Начало года! И мы рады поделиться с вами обзором новых бесплатных курсов виртуальной академии Microsoft MVA. Регулярно эксперты Microsoft продолжают выпускать курсы и готовить материалы специально для вас, чтобы предоставлять актуальную информацию разработчикам и ИТ-профессионалам.

Новинка! Управление жизненным циклом приложений (ALM) для начинающих компаний
Вы собирается выпустить свой первый продукт в качестве предпринимателя? В этом курсе можно ознакомиться с основными принципами инженерного управления жизненным циклом приложений, которые необходимы при реализации вашей мечты. Рассматривается система управления версиями, управление выпусками, автоматизированное тестирование и многое другое. Узнайте, что означают такие термины, как Git, SCRUM и TDD, и выясните, почему они могут обеспечить более высокое качество первого выпуска, чем у конкурентов.
Читать дальше →
Всего голосов 16: ↑13 и ↓3+10
Комментарии0

Использование Arduino UNO в качестве программатора

Время на прочтение3 мин
Количество просмотров237K
Появилась у меня идея сделать внешний интерфейс для счетчика воды, чтобы не лазать в подвал для снятия показаний. После некоторых размышлений я остановился на ATTiny2313A(стоит ~80р, а ставить для этого Arduino ценой в ~1000р. мне жаба не дает) + несколько резисторов, кнопок и 7-ми сегментный индикатор. Но остановился перед проблемой — в отличии от Arduino здесь нужен программатор. Поскольку я не сильно увлекаюсь МК, то программаторов у меня как-то не водится. Arduino теоретически можно использовать в этом качестве, но реально я этого никогда не делал.
Пришла пора заняться этим на практике...
Всего голосов 36: ↑30 и ↓6+24
Комментарии15

Советы начинающим программистам микроконтроллеров

Время на прочтение10 мин
Количество просмотров219K
Очень давно хотелось поделиться своим опытом, с начинающими радиолюбителями, потому что об этом пишут очень мало и разрозненно. Мой опыт не хороший, не плохой, он такой какой есть. С некоторыми утверждениями вы в праве не согласиться и это нормально, ведь у каждого свое видение ситуации. Цель данного материала, обратить внимание читателя на некоторые вещи, что то взять на заметку и сформировать собственное мнение и видение ситуации, ни в коем случае нельзя воспринимать это как истину.
Читать дальше →
Всего голосов 54: ↑51 и ↓3+48
Комментарии87

Как я в 2015 году космонавтику популяризовывал

Время на прочтение4 мин
Количество просмотров11K


Одно из моих первых воспоминаний — в три года я искренне радуюсь, что наступает такой замечательный 1989 год. Сейчас Новый Год превратился в гильотину, которая отрезает последние дни года и ехидно ухмыляется «Не успел!» Что ж, хочешь, не хочешь, надо отчитываться за 2015 год. Может быть, кому-нибудь это будет полезно.
Читать дальше →
Всего голосов 43: ↑40 и ↓3+37
Комментарии18

Прототип бионического протеза руки Артопро

Время на прочтение3 мин
Количество просмотров9.9K
​​Здравствуйте! Мы развиваем проект роботизированных и тяговых протезов верхних конечностей. В России почти миллион людей, пострадавших от потери одной или нескольких конечностей. Каждый четвертый из них — ребенок. При этом протезов, позволяющих заместить не только косметический вид, но и функцию конечности, в России нет — собственные протезы такого типа не выпускаются, а импортные стоят десятки и сотни тысяч евро. Особенно это касается детских протезов — а ведь ребенок растет, и нуждается в ежегодной замене протеза просто по причине роста. Все это в конечном итоге выливается в ограничения и социальную дезадаптацию инвалидов, в особенности детей, и огромную, но при этом невидимую для общества проблему.


Читать дальше →
Всего голосов 10: ↑8 и ↓2+6
Комментарии17

Тяговые протезы для детей и взрослых, выполненные на 3D-принтере

Время на прочтение2 мин
Количество просмотров10K
Детали для тяговых протезов компания «Моторика» изготавливает на 3D-принтере. Протез приводится в движение благодаря изменению положения кисти. Устройство состоит из каркаса и приёмной гильзы и изготавливается индивидуально, учитывая размеры и виды травмы. Стоимость протеза — от пятидесяти до ста тысяч рублей в зависимости от травмы.

image
Читать дальше →
Всего голосов 10: ↑9 и ↓1+8
Комментарии4

Подборка бесплатных инструментов для разработчиков

Время на прочтение28 мин
Количество просмотров186K
Сегодня мы представляем вашему вниманию адаптированную подборку инструментов (в том числе облачных) для разработчиков, которые позволяют создавать по-настоящему качественные проекты. Здесь представлены исключительно SaaS, PaaS и IaaS сервисы, предоставляющие бесплатные пакеты для разработчиков инфраструктурного ПО.

Читать дальше →
Всего голосов 96: ↑89 и ↓7+82
Комментарии38

Информация

В рейтинге
Не участвует
Откуда
Эстония
Дата рождения
Зарегистрирован
Активность

Специализация

Fullstack Developer
Senior